From 7c713bc8035bc4093f06c984271e25e875c5e3a3 Mon Sep 17 00:00:00 2001 From: fiftyeightandeight Date: Thu, 14 Mar 2024 17:36:43 +0800 Subject: [PATCH] update print event on token-lqstx::transfer --- contracts/token-lqstx.clar | 7 ++++--- deployments/default.simnet-plan.yaml | 1 - 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/contracts/token-lqstx.clar b/contracts/token-lqstx.clar index dc80bf1..e04f779 100644 --- a/contracts/token-lqstx.clar +++ b/contracts/token-lqstx.clar @@ -109,10 +109,11 @@ ;; public calls (define-public (transfer (amount uint) (sender principal) (recipient principal) (memo (optional (buff 2048)))) - (begin + (let ( + (shares (get-tokens-to-shares amount))) (asserts! (or (is-eq tx-sender sender) (is-eq contract-caller sender)) err-unauthorised) - (try! (ft-transfer? lqstx (get-tokens-to-shares amount) sender recipient)) - (print { type: "transfer", amount: amount, sender: sender, recipient: recipient, memo: memo }) + (try! (ft-transfer? lqstx shares sender recipient)) + (print { notification: "transfer", payload: { amount: amount, shares: shares, sender: sender, recipient: recipient, memo: memo } }) (ok true))) ;; private functions diff --git a/deployments/default.simnet-plan.yaml b/deployments/default.simnet-plan.yaml index 5e3b9c1..06d9be1 100644 --- a/deployments/default.simnet-plan.yaml +++ b/deployments/default.simnet-plan.yaml @@ -39,7 +39,6 @@ genesis: - pox - pox-2 - pox-3 - - pox-4 - lockup - costs-2 - costs-3